Shadows of the Past: A Walk of the Damned

In the dimly lit cell, the air was thick with the scent of despair and the lingering taste of betrayal. Aiden's heart raced as he lay on the cold, damp floor, his muscles tense from days without rest. The shadows danced around him, whispering secrets of a world he had thought he had left behind.

He had been a soldier once, a man of honor and courage. But that was a lifetime ago, a story he had hoped to leave behind with the man he loved. Yet, here he was, trapped in a place where the past refused to let go.

The cell door creaked open, and a figure stepped inside, the light from the corridor casting long, sinister shadows. It was the torturer, a man with a name that was a whisper on the lips of the prisoners, a name that sent shivers down Aiden's spine.

"You should have stayed silent," the torturer said, his voice like ice. "You should have accepted your fate and left him alone."

Aiden's eyes narrowed. "Fate? You think this is fate?"

The torturer chuckled, a sound that seemed to echo through the cell. "No, this is a lesson. A lesson in loyalty, in silence, and in the price of love."

The door closed behind the torturer, leaving Aiden alone with his thoughts and the echoes of the words he had heard. He had loved Marcus deeply, a man of the world, a man who had no place in Aiden's world of honor and duty. Yet, they had found each other, and for a time, they had been happy.

But happiness was a fragile thing, and their love had been no exception. Betrayal had come in the form of a traitor, a man who had sought to destroy everything Aiden held dear. And now, he was paying the price.

Aiden's thoughts drifted to Marcus, to the look of betrayal that had crossed his face the night they had been separated. He had tried to reach him, to warn him, but it had been too late. Marcus was gone, lost in the chaos of a world that had turned against them.

The torturer returned, and Aiden's heart sank as he saw the cruel gleam in the man's eyes. "Your time is almost up," the torturer said. "The game is nearly over."

Aiden's fingers tightened into fists. "I won't give you the satisfaction."

The torturer's eyes narrowed. "Oh, but you will. You will beg for it, and you will taste the full weight of your mistake."

As the torturer began his torturous routine, Aiden's mind raced. He needed to escape, to find a way to reach Marcus, to save him from the same fate that awaited him. But how could he when the walls of his cell seemed to close in on him with every passing moment?

The pain was excruciating, but Aiden clung to the hope that one day, he would be free. He would find a way to reach Marcus, to show him that love could overcome even the darkest of times.

In the heart of the night, as the torturer paused, Aiden's eyes met the shadowy figure's. "I will not be broken," he said, his voice a whisper of determination. "I will not let them win."

The torturer's eyes widened, and for a moment, Aiden thought he had struck a chord. "You are stronger than you think," the torturer said, his voice softening. "But remember, strength is not just in the body. It is in the heart."

Aiden's heart raced, but he did not respond. He knew the truth of the torturer's words. Strength was in the heart, and Aiden's heart was full of love for Marcus, a love that would never fade, no matter the cost.

As dawn approached, Aiden's resolve only grew stronger. He would survive this, he would find a way to escape, and he would find Marcus. They would face whatever challenges lay ahead together, because love was not something that could be broken by shadows or by time.

The torturer left, and Aiden's thoughts turned to Marcus. He visualized their reunion, the joy that would fill their hearts, and the promise of a future that was truly free from the shadows of the past.

And so, Aiden endured, knowing that each day brought him closer to redemption, to the day when he could once again stand with Marcus, hand in hand, ready to face whatever lay ahead.

The end.
